This is a pair of Nike Air Max Plus sneakers, characterized by their vibrant 'University Red' monochromatic colorway. The upper is constructed from a breathable mesh base with the iconic TPU welded 'ribs' or cages that provide structural support and a wave-like aesthetic that mimics palm trees. A small, jewel-like Nike Swoosh in black with a contrasting white outline is visible on the lateral side. The shoe features a thick, sculpted polyurethane midsole with visible 'Tuned Air' units in both the heel and forefoot, which are designed for targeted cushioning. The construction includes a red toe cap and mudguard, while the lacing system consists of flat red laces passing through webbed eyelets. Internally, the shoe features a padded collar and a visible manufacturing tag on the underside of the tongue. The condition appears to be pre-owned but well-maintained; there is no immediate evidence of significant scuffing, cracking of the plastic cages, or fogging of the air units, though some light surface dust is visible from being on a retail shelf. Based on the style and colorway, this model likely dates from the late 2010s to early 2020s, reflecting high-quality athletic footwear craftsmanship with specialized multi-density rubber outsoles.

I have conducted a visual examination of this Nike Air Max Plus (Tuned 1) in the 'University Red' colorway. This monochromatic iteration of the Sean McDowell-designed classic remains a high-demand staple within the 'Tn' collector community. Upon inspection, the TPU cages appear well-adhered without the delamination often seen in older or counterfeit pairs. The Air units maintain good clarity, and the geometric integrity of the polyurethane midsole suggests the foam has not yet begun the hydrolysis process. The 'Tn' heel branding and jewel Swoosh alignment conform to standard Nike manufacturing specifications for this era. Market demand for monochromatic red colorways remains seasonally strong, particularly in European and Australian markets where this silhouette holds 'cult' status. Current secondary market data for pre-owned examples in this 'Excellent' condition range from $160 to $210, whereas deadstock pairs can exceed $280. The value is buoyed by the popularity of the 'University Red' palette but regulated by the fact that this was a non-limited general release. Limitations: This appraisal is based strictly on photographic evidence. I cannot verify the structural integrity of the internal shanks or the scent of the materials, which is often a key indicator of authenticity in sneakers. A full authentication would require a physical inspection of the 'stitch-density' on the tongue tag, UV light examination of the midsole adhesives for factory inconsistencies, and verification of the SKU code against Nike’s internal database. Original packaging and a verified retail receipt would further solidify the upper bound of this valuation.
